Wrangell Airport is a state-owned public-use airport located one nautical mile northeast of the central business district of Wrangell, a city and borough in the U.S. state of Alaska which has no road access to the outside world.

Wrangell is a borough in Alaska, United States. As of the 2020 census the population was around 2,127, down from 2,369 in 2010. Incorporated as a Unified Home Rule Borough on May 30, 2008, Wrangell was previously a city in the Wrangell-Petersburg Census Area, which was afterwards renamed the Petersburg Census Area.
